2007 Alagappa University M.B.A Financial Management RURAL BANKING Question paper
(2005 onwards) Time : Three hours Maximum : 100 marks PART A — (5 * 8 = 40 marks) Answer any FIVE questions.
1. Point out the features of a Co-operative Bank. 2. Discuss the need for rural banking. 3. Write short notes on IRDA. 4. Explain the concept of priority sector lending. 5. Narrate the features of 20 point Programme. 6. Bring out any two schemes implemented recently for the development of women in rural areas. 7. What is a Lead Bank scheme? 8. What are the functions of DIC.
PART B — (4 × 15 = 60 marks) Answer any THREE questions from Question No. 9 to Question No. 14 and Question No. 15 is compulsory.
9. Discuss the functions of a Co-Operative Bank. 10. Discuss the role of Commercial banks in rural lending. 11. Explain the progress and problems of credit planning at the gross root level. 12. Elaborate the role of banks in providing self employment to educated unemployed youth. 13. Narrate the Components of Service Area Approach. 14. Discuss the role of SIDBI in supporting rural development. 15. Elaborate the schemes offered by KVIC.
